Como executar uma segunda instância de inicialização do Windows 7 em outra partição?

1

* Este é o meu primeiro post / pergunta - Eu acredito que é um problema / desafio muito semelhante ao do isipro em -

Obtenha a partição de inicialização para reconhecer um segundo sistema operacional

mas parece que estou direcionado a fazer minha própria pergunta vs responder ou expandir a deles.

Meu cenário:

base.0 = imagem do 1º Drive Snapshot de win.7x64sp1 Ultimate, apenas drivers + utilitários mínimos

base.1 = imagem da segunda imagem de unidade da mesma [win.7x64sp1 final], 75% todas as aplicações instaladas

base.2 = 3ª imagem do Drive Image do mesmo [win.7x64sp1 Ultimate], 100% de todos os aplicativos instalados

..... * base.2 é instalado em C: \ como a unidade de inicialização -
Eu tenho uma partição de 100 MB System Reserved w / BCD.

Não tenho problema em recriar imagens em C: \ para alterar entre & atualize as diferentes imagens do DS,
mas eu quero ser capaz de inicializar nativamente em uma instância de qualquer imagem em uma segunda partição,
com a opção disponível no momento da inicialização.

Usar uma imagem já preparada economiza tempo, obviamente por não ter que investir o tempo de configuração / ajuste novamente.

Eu quero uma máquina de boot nativa vs. uma máquina virtual OU vhd - embora eu use isso para outros propósitos.

Meu objetivo:

Eu quero instalar minha imagem de base.0 em uma partição B: \, para fins de inicialização nativa (nenhuma máquina virtual desejada para isso) em uma instância separada de um sistema operacional mínimo
para fins de teste de aplicativos.

Esta instância separada persistirá em todas as reinicializações até que eu deseje refazer a imagem & "comece de novo"
de uma linha de base inalterada.

  • Eu segui os passos para configurar o BCD como descrito por Jamie Hanrahan no tópico da isipro, e obtenho sucesso no CMD, bem como uma entrada separada na inicialização,
    então parece que tudo parece / parece bom.

** Problema:

- quando eu seleciono a nova entrada de inicialização, a máquina inicializa na partição desejada B: \,

- conforme evidenciado na coluna "Status" do Gerenciamento de disco:

B: = (saudável, inicialização, despejo de memória, unidade lógica)
C: = (saudável, partição primária)

- mas é a base.2 INSTÂNCIA do SO que é realmente inicializado - NÃO é a base.0 que pretendo,

- como evidenciado pela presença da área de trabalho base.2, menu Iniciar, aplicativos, etc.

Aprecio muito a ajuda para entender o que / como outros componentes internos precisam ser alterados - além da nova entrada do BCD, para que esse tipo de procedimento seja bem-sucedido.

Obrigado

    
por newsome 15.06.2015 / 17:51

2 respostas

0

ATUALMENTE !! Sucesso depois de vários anos imaginando / experimentando / falhando !!

Talvez este tópico deva ser renomeado -

"clones nativos de inicialização 2 (idênticos ou diferenciais) da mesma linhagem, no mesmo disco (de diferentes partições, é claro) "

Breve descrição: ASS-huming você entende, & implementar corretamente, um BCD adequado

[que pode ser uma ASSUNÇÃO enorme para muitos peeps],

então toda essa missão não envolve o BCD, por si só -

envolve remover identificadores específicos e configurações de registro dentro da própria instalação do SO - o que me leva ao .....

Solução Curta: Sysprep a instalação!

(aviso: você pode estar em uma curva de aprendizado íngreme enquanto resolve os problemas particulares que SUA imagem de instalação principal apresenta)

Isso é o que finalmente funcionou - o que finalmente permitiu que o clone [sysprepped] fosse instalado para uma partição diferente no mesmo disco que seu pai, e inicializar de forma independente, sem quaisquer referências ou sobrescritos a / do seu pai.

Solução média-curta: Use máquinas virtuais ou VHDs - possivelmente muito mais rápido de implantar, & oferecendo várias opções sobre como elas são criadas, etc.

Solução média-longa: se resignar a instalar manualmente o & config o sistema operacional tudo de novo - MAS !!

usando tantos aplicativos portáteis quanto possível - de terceiros ou crie seu próprio w / [$$$] VMWare-Thinapp, Spoon-Xenocode, Cameyo, etc.

Então, ao investir tempo na preparação do seu próprio Gold Master personalizado, faça um arquivo de log cuidadoso [+ tampas de tela] da ordem das instalações, ajustes, etc. para guiá-lo e reduzir o tempo necessário para implantações futuras.

Eu acho o "MyUninstaller" do Nir Sofer uma ferramenta indispensável, como tem colunas para mostrar a instalação Data - Hora - Versão - Nome do aplicativo - etc., que eu faço um screencap de & use como minha referência do que foi feito quando, etc.

Solução longa / resposta longa: Invista tempo estudando & aprendendo a documentação da Microsoft das ferramentas de implantação gratuitas!

Acredito firmemente que pessoas como eu postam esse tipo de pergunta em busca de métodos fáceis de usar, porque nós realmente queremos que Nuhi reencarne nLite / vLite com um método point-and-click / no-THought-involved de lidar com o Windows 7 - > 8 > 10 > futuro do sistema operacional!

... oh, e jogue um pouco do DAZ Loader ou do KMSPico enquanto estamos nisso, hein?

[apenas para cuidar desse conceito traquina de ..... "Eu sei que tecnicamente PODER, mas legalmente - posso?"]

Ouça - existem métodos LEGAL para testes EXTENDED [re-Arms] do sistema operacional Windows, mais, o que você acha Nuhi, et. al., base / base seus métodos de implantação GUI em ??

- o Microsoft subjacente "api" se você quiser, que é tão disponível para você e eu para quebrar nosso burro estudando e aprendendo, como foi para Nuhi, et. al. - que aparentemente pagaram o tempo / preço ao Mestre!

E se tudo isso for demais, aproveite os VHDs, que são um bom compromisso entre -

"Sim, legalmente permitiremos que você faça isso - mas somente com essas Edições [Enterprise / Ultimate]".

paz e feliz implantação!

    
por 23.06.2015 / 18:41
0

Cada Windows Vista, carregador do Windows 7/8/10 especifica duas letras de unidade para o seu destino (o sistema operacional a ser inicializado) - "dispositivo" e "osdevice".

Você pode usar bcdedit /enum all /v para ver todos os carregadores presentes no BCD.

bcdedit /set ... 

pode ser usado para alterar todos os parâmetros de um carregador.

Para facilitar a visualização e a alteração do conteúdo BCD completo, use o Editor Visual BCD .

A versão 0.9.3.1 da ferramenta também pode criar carregadores automáticos para instalações do Windows 7 que não tenham uma entrada (loader) no BCD. Procure a opção "Criar carregadores do Windows ausentes" ao clicar com o botão direito do mouse.

    
por 18.06.2015 / 08:11